For all Beta Users who did not flashed/activate your car yet

Our updated MG Flasher ver 1.1.1 today morning available to download has corrected function when MG Flasher detects old software installed in your car it will automatically perform update to the never level. You will be asked to confirm it just before activation/ECU unlock. The software update will be performed followed by ECU unlock at the same time - the whole process is about 1 minute longer.
All previous activations were performed with the newest level software as well.

Okay, I got my MY18 340i MPPSK 6sp 93oct unlocked yesterday mid-day and have my first impressions to share.

I had a bad cable from bimmergeeks and issues unlocking on Monday. Jarek was instrumental in helping diagnose this. We had multiple emails back and forth, him taking a look at logs, etc. After borrowing a (slower) k+DCan cable from a friend yesterday all was good and I got unlocked, flashed and drove st1, st2, and the custom st2 map with my features (to be available to the end user on MG Flasher release). My thoughts below are on mostly st2 custom.

It has been rainy and very cold here, so driving impressions are limited. First, there is much more power down low in the rev range, and power is delivered very smoothly and super strong up towards the higher revs. Full throttle on my snow tires this morning was useless in all 3 low gears. I concentrated on a half throttle run for traction and was SHOCKED at how it pulled. And I am still adapting. The sound is a bit more tuned now, I am definitely hearing more turbo and (maybe) wastegate noises. I love it. Now I need at least some better weather and my summer tires back!

Cold start delete is awesome, I love putting it in sport and having the exhaust valves open immediately on startup, they used to take 2 minutes to open.

Love the gauge hijacking for power and torque, fun to show friends'.

We all know that customer service is KEY in auto tuning. Each setup has many variables that an engine tuner must account for a smooth working end product. Jarek has obviously put in the time to make the flashing process seamless for the end user. But even more than that, his immediate to the point responses on BETA launch are INVALUABLE. My experience couldn't be any better at the moment. Thanks Jarek, I cannot wait for st3! --MW
